Output 50b7055c44301654ed2545120bfb1c597245a4f85f64a4f308d12526dc8877a2:5

value
1999985000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37636f3185851af6b3855e06e319ad9cb174e OP_EQUAL
address
3BMEXhwbEcmcT4hULLbeXzAQczCT1tE8Qy
transaction
50b7055c44301654ed2545120bfb1c597245a4f85f64a4f308d12526dc8877a2
spent
true